
Flat 0.05% w/w Cream
Manufacturer
Sunways India Pvt Ltd
Salt Composition
Fluticasone Propionate (0.05% w/w)
Key Information
Short Description
Flat 0.05% w/w Cream is a steroid medicine used to treat skin conditions with inflammation and itching such as eczema, dermatitis, and psoriasis.
Dosage Form
Cream
Introduction
Flat 0.05% w/w Cream is only meant for external use and should be used as advised by your doctor. You should normally wash and dry the affected area before applying a thin layer of the medicine. Avoid any contact with your eyes, nose, or mouth. Rinse it off with plenty of water in case of accidental contact. Avoid covering the treated area with airtight dressings such as bandages unless directed by a doctor. Using of the medicine may cause itching or burning sensation, irritation, redness, and swelling at the site of application. These side effects are temporary and usually go away with time. However, if they persist or worsen, let your doctor know. Pregnant and breastfeeding mothers should consult their doctors before using this medicine. It should not be used in children below 3 months of age.
Directions for Use
This medicine is for external use only. Use it in the dose and duration as advised by your doctor. Clean and dry the affected area and apply the cream. Wash your hands after applying unless hands are the affected area.

Breastfeeding Warning
Flat 0.05% w/w Cream is probably safe to use during breastfeeding. Limited human data suggests that the drug does not represent any significant risk to the baby. However, avoid applying Flat 0.05% w/w Cream on the breasts to avoid accidental ingestion by the infant.
Pregnancy Warning
Flat 0.05% w/w Cream may be unsafe to use during pregnancy. Although there are limited studies in humans, animal studies have shown harmful effects on the developing baby. Your doctor will weigh the benefits and any potential risks before prescribing it to you. Please consult your doctor.

How it works
Flat 0.05% w/w Cream is a steroid medicine. It works by blocking the production of certain chemical messengers that make the skin red, swollen, and itchy due to skin conditions such as atopic eczema, allergic contact dermatitis, and psoriasis.
Quick Tips
You have been prescribed Flat 0.05% w/w Cream for treating itchy red rashes and skin irritation associated with skin conditions such as atopic eczema, allergic contact dermatitis, and psoriasis among others. Don't use it more often or for longer than advised by your doctor. Don't apply it to broken or infected areas of skin, face, eyes, or eyelids. Don't cover the area being treated with airtight dressings such as bandages unless directed by a doctor. If you think the area of skin you are treating has become infected, you should stop using Flat 0.05% w/w Cream and consult your doctor. If your skin condition has not improved after two weeks of treatment, consult your doctor.

Frequently asked questions
What is Flat 0.05% w/w Cream? What is it used for?
Flat 0.05% w/w Cream belongs to a class of medications known as corticosteroids, also referred to as steroids. It is used to treat various allergic skin conditions such as eczema and atopic dermatitis. Flat 0.05% w/w Cream effectively reduces symptoms associated with these conditions, including swelling, itching, and redness.
How does Flat 0.05% w/w Cream work?
Flat 0.05% w/w Cream works by reducing inflammation caused by allergies. It does this by blocking the release of certain natural substances that trigger allergic symptoms such as swelling, redness and pain.
How long does Flat 0.05% w/w Cream take to start working?
The time for Flat 0.05% w/w Cream to start showing effects may vary from person to person. Usually, it starts providing relief within 8 hours of starting the medication. It may even take several days before you experience maximum benefits. For quicker symptom improvement, consistently taking the medicine is crucial for maximizing its benefit.
Is Flat 0.05% w/w Cream safe for burns?
No, Flat 0.05% w/w Cream should never be applied to areas of the skin that have burns, cuts or scrapes. If Flat 0.05% w/w Cream gets onto such areas accidentally, rinse the area thoroughly with water. It is advisable that you use this medicine only as directed by your doctor to avoid adverse effects and worsening of your condition.
How to use Flat 0.05% w/w Cream?
Before using Flat 0.05% w/w Cream, clean and dry the affected area. Gently massage the medication into the skin. Be careful not to get the medication in your eyes or mouth. If Flat 0.05% w/w Cream gets in your eyes accidentally, wash with plenty of water and contact your doctor if your eyes are irritated.
What precautions do I need to take while using Flat 0.05% w/w Cream?
Be careful not to get Flat 0.05% w/w Cream into your eyes or mouth. If you happen to get it in your eyes, rinse off with plenty of water immediately and contact your doctor. You must not use Flat 0.05% w/w Cream if you are allergic to it or any of its ingredients. Tell your doctor if you notice an allergic reaction while using the medication for the first time. Inform your doctor if you are taking any medicines regularly to prevent any allergic reaction with other medications. Do not cover the area being treated with Flat 0.05% w/w Cream with a bandage, as this may increase absorption of this medicine and increase side effects. Do not use more than what is recommended for symptom relief.
